2006-07 Officers and Board of Governors elected

The Columbus Bar membership elected three new members to join the 2006-07 Board of Governors. Elected to first-time terms are David S. Bloomfield Jr., Porter Wright Morris & Arthur; David T. Patterson, Curly Patterson & Bush; and Bradley B. Wrightsel, Wrightsel & Wrightsel. Hon. James L. Graham, U.S. District Court, Southern District of Ohio; Stephen L. McIntosh, Chief Prosecutor, City Attorney’s Office; and Kristy J. Swope, Swope & Swope, were re-elected to second terms.

The secretary/treasurer position was won by Kathleen M. Trafford, Porter Wright Morris & Arthur, who ran for office with one year remaining on her second term. The Board will name an appointee to fill the one-year vacancy immediately following the Annual Meeting. Trafford will join Belinda S. Barnes, Lane Alton & Horst, who will be sworn in as president, culminating her six years of service on the board - four as a board member and the last two as a Columbus Bar officer - and Nelson E Genshaft, Strip Hoppers Leithart McGrath & Terlecky, who will be installed as president-elect.

All newly-elected members will be sworn in at the Annual Meeting on June 9 at the Marriott Renaissance Hotel. They will join sitting board members Marie-Joëlle Khouzam, Carlile Patchen & Murphy; Robert G. Palmer, Robert Gray Palmer Co.; Mark C. Petrucci, Morgan & Petrucci; and Elizabeth J. Watters, Chester Willcox & Saxbe. Current president Sally W. Bloomfield, Bricker & Eckler, will serve one more year as past president.
